Artist: Paul Thek

Galerie Buchholz presents a new exhibition of Paul Thek in New York, the gallery’s second solo exhibition since co-representing the estate of the artist. Following the first exhibition which focused exclusively on a cycle of early paintings from 1963-1964, this exhibition brings together newspaper paintings, paintings on canvas, and drawings made between 1969 and 1987 as well as a 1971 sculptural installation and a quilted flag from 1977.

At the opening, Andrew Durbin, author of the newly published biography “The Wonderful World That Almost Was: A Life of Peter Hujar and Paul Thek,” and the artists Moyra Davey and Rebecca Quaytman will lead a tour. The exhibition was conceived in collaboration with the Estate of Paul Thek and the Paul Thek Foundation, and runs parallel to an exhibition of Paul Thek’s work at Pace Gallery, along with a group exhibition organized by Andrew Durbin at Ortuzar Projects.
